This may be an answer to those whining about lag and bugs. When they released this PRE-RELEASE UPDATE, they only gave us the minecraft.jar file. There are other .jar files in the bin directory that minecraft uses as well. I am guessing that some of the crafting routines are accessed from these files. And since the files currently in your bin folder are still for 1.7.3, 1.8 can't use them and this may be the reason for some crashes.
As far as the Enderman sounding like zombies, the minecraft.jar they gave us calls for sounds from the resources directory. Which does not have the Enderman sounds in it for obvious reasons. WE ONLY HAVE THE .JAR FILE. So the coders temporarily made the Enderman use zombie sounds. I am sure that there is special sounds for these mobs. So we will just have to wait for the official release to hear those creepy sounds.
